The Highest Mountain In The Solar System

Olympus is the highest mountain in the solar system located on Mars.
This is an extinct volcano 21.2 km in height and 540 km in width, and the depth of the crater is 3 km.
Olympus area is so large that it can not be fully seen from the surface of Mars.
Age of Olympus is about 2 million years.
